Acceleration is defined as which of the following?

Explanation:
Acceleration is the rate at which velocity changes over time. Since velocity includes both speed and direction, acceleration captures speeding up, slowing down, or a change in direction. Mathematically, it’s the derivative of velocity with respect to time (a = dv/dt), with units of meters per second squared. So, when a car goes from 0 to 20 m/s in 5 seconds, its acceleration is 4 m/s^2 in the forward direction. If it keeps 20 m/s but reorients from north to east, there is still acceleration because the velocity vector has changed, even though the speed is the same. The other descriptions aren’t the best fit: the rate of change of position is velocity, not acceleration; distance traveled per unit time is speed, not acceleration; and “increase in the rate of motion” is vague and can miss the essential idea that acceleration is about changes in velocity, not just a faster overall motion.
